About the Program:
Ser.en.dip.i.ty [ser-uhn-dip-i-tee]- Noun 1. Luck in making desirable discoveries by accident
Serendipity is a fun, loving, child- centred and play-based early learning program where the curriculum is based on observations of the children’s interests to create child led projects and a child led environment ~ the emergent curriculum, as well as a gentle introduction to Montessori Programming. Children will have the opportunity to develop their intellectual, emotional, social, creative and physical skills through a variety of activities throughout the day at their own pace during structured and non-structured times, inside and outside.
I believe that children need to feel safe and secure in their environment, before they can learn and grow and make discoveries. Building strong relationships with each child and family is my primary emphasis.
I believe every child is an individual, and is unique and I aim to provide each of them what they need in order to develop at their own pace.
I believe that children learn best through play and social interactions. Children are encouraged to become as independent as possible, through role modeling, positive reinforcement, trust, love and care.
My goal is to provide opportunities to assist your child in developing a positive self image which includes self acceptance and a healthy sense of confidence in his or her own abilities.
I provide experiences and activities that will fulfill your child’s individual developmental needs (social, emotional, creative, intellectual, and physical).
I provide guidance in helping your child in becoming a responsible individual, respecting the feelings of others, and offer experiences that will stimulate an interest in future learning.
Serendipity offers a 1:10 Educator to Child ratio for the morning preschool program, 1:8 Educator to Child ratio for the afternoons for group care.

Flow of the Day: Please note that while there is a schedule of activities, I have not marked the times as everyday the times can be different, however, the routine stays the same.
Outside: Children's parents/guardians will come to the play yard and drop off their child and go inside and sign them in for the day and put their snack in the basket. We spend a lot of our time outdoors playing, exploring, creating and enjoying nature. Our time outside is at least 1/2 hour long, sometimes we spend the entire days outside too!
Children come in and remove outdoor wear and put on indoor shoes, wash hands and play (am engage in open snack)
Gathering: A "group led" gathering to talk about what is happening for the children. Sing songs, read stories, etc. emerging on the children's needs and interests of the day. Montessori activities will be presented to the group at this time.
Open Snack: Children will wash their hands and join at the tables to have a healthy snack and water. Snack times are an important time of the day for the children where we teach hygiene, sharing taking turns and healthy eating. Children will have the opportunity to socialize with all the children at the table, while having their snacks.
Play: Children will have the opportunity to learn through their experiences at each of the centres to hear, move, listen, see and touch the materials. Such centres as: home-living, science, music, art, blocks and manipulatives. Children will have opportunities to develop their curiosity, socialize, problem solve, express their thoughts and feelings, share, take turns, and be a part of the learning environment. During this time we also bake, make play dough and have science experiments.
During play time children will have one on one Montessori presentations and have the opportunity to explore and engage with the Montessori Materials set out for them.
